I like
Shell Rotella straight 30wt diesel oil. No clutch slip
In a pinch:
Castrol Straight 30 wt oil and I blend in the zinc additive found at most auto parts stores.
I'm trying Castrol 30 wt with 10% straight 50 wt racing oil.
Both of the above oils give some clutch slip under heavy acceleration.
Since I live .5 miles from work, no lights or stop signs (except on the way back) I live with a little slippage until I find my Rotella again.
Never, but never, use Chevron straight 30 wt oil. I did and it glued my clutch plates tight.
